Description from extension meta
Browser extension to search and analyze the chat logs of Twitch VODs
Image from store
Description from store
v4.0:
New UI, more channel support for faster fetching, emote support.
v3.1.1:
API update
v3.0:
All channels are now supported.
Source Code: https://github.com/burakdrk/searchsen
